Why Accurate Reports Matter in Food Production

The importance of accurate reports in food production cannot be overstated. These reports provide clear, reliable information that helps workers and managers make good decisions every day. In a kitchen or production area, keeping precise records ensures food safety, quality control, and smooth operations.

Accurate reports help track stock levels, ingredient usage, and production output. This prevents food wastage and ensures that supplies are ordered in time. If reports are vague or wrong, it can lead to shortages or overstocking, both of which cost money and may disrupt work.

In terms of food safety, detailed reports allow for easy tracing of any problems. For example, if there is a contamination or allergy concern, accurate documentation helps identify the source quickly. This can prevent potential health risks to customers and keep your workplace compliant with health regulations.

Managers also use reports to assess employee performance and production efficiency. Clear records show how well tasks are completed and if any improvements are needed. Without accurate data, it is hard to measure success or fix problems.

Key Benefits of Keeping Accurate Food Production Reports

  1. Improves food safety: Helps track hygiene and ingredient quality.
  2. Supports inventory control: Prevents waste and ensures stock availability.
  3. Enhances decision-making: Provides reliable data for managers.
  4. Ensures compliance: Meets legal and health standards.
  5. Records production output: Monitors efficiency and productivity.

For food production assistants, producing accurate reports is part of the job. This means taking time to write down correct information, double-checking numbers, and following a clear format. Using simple language and organised layouts can help others understand the reports easily.

In summary, accurate reports are essential tools in food production. They protect health, save money, and improve work quality. Learning how to prepare precise and clear reports is a valuable skill that supports the success of any food production team.
